Priority: medium Bug ID: 59418 Assignee: libreoffice-bugs@lists.freedesktop.org Summary: EDITING: enhancement request: change of key allocation Severity: normal Classification: Unclassified OS: Windows (All) Reporter: bugquestcon...@online.de Hardware: Other Whiteboard: BSA Status: UNCONFIRMED Version: 3.6.4.3 release Component: Spreadsheet Product: LibreOffice quote: Absolute reference is set to Shift+F4 (because F4 is set to Data Sources). This is quite annoying since F4 is the STANDARD key since Lotus 123... unquote Above quote is from http://ask.libreoffice.org/en/question/9898/asbolute-cell-reference-shortcut-key/?answer=9900#post-id-9900 I do feel the same and just changed the key allocation my self. However, it would avoid a lot of frustration and questions in AskLibO if the the key allocation could be changed to F4= absolute/relative reference and Shift-F4 = Datasource.
